A well-established engineering and manufacturing business is looking to recruit a Project Engineer to support a major upcoming installation project on site.

Location: Leicestershire

Fully site-based

Salary: £50,000

The Role

  • Lead the installation of capital equipment and site improvement projects from concept through to handover
  • Manage project timelines

How to prepare for a job interview at WR Engineering

Know Your Technical Stuff

As a Technisch Project Engineer, you'll need to demonstrate your technical knowledge. Brush up on the specifics of capital equipment installation and be ready to discuss any relevant projects you've worked on. This shows you're not just familiar with the theory but have practical experience too.

Showcase Your Project Management Skills

Be prepared to talk about how you manage project timelines and resources. Use examples from past experiences where you successfully led a project from concept to handover. Highlight any tools or methodologies you used, like Agile or Lean, to keep things on track.

Understand the Company Culture

Research the engineering and manufacturing business you're interviewing with. Understand their values and how they approach projects. This will help you tailor your answers to align with their culture, showing that you're a great fit for the team.

Ask Insightful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t shy away from asking questions. Inquire about the specific challenges they face in capital equipment installation or how they measure project success. This not only shows your interest but also gives you valuable insights into the role.
